Koh Samui · Month comparison
July vs April
April ranks #1 overall vs July at #7. Songkran brings Thai New Year festivities — warm, slightly wetter, but culturally unmissable.
July
#7 of 12 months
Strong option
Second peak season: European summer holidays bring the crowds back to reliably sunny skies.
- ↑Rain drops dramatically from June — one of the drier months outside the Jan–Apr window
- ↑Sunshine hours rise again: good beach weather most days with manageable humidity
April
#1 of 12 months
Best match
Songkran brings Thai New Year festivities — warm, slightly wetter, but culturally unmissable.
- ↑Songkran water festival (13–15 April) transforms Na Thon and Chaweng into celebrations of Thai New Year
- ↑Good value accommodation: 30–35% below peak-season rates with weather still mostly excellent
| Factor | July | April |
|---|---|---|
| Weather score | 7 | 7 |
| Value score | 4 | 6 |
| Crowd score | 3 | 6 |
| Events score | 5 | 7 |
| Atmosphere | 7 | 8 |
| Avg high temp | 31.5°C | 32.8°C |
| Monthly rain | 98mm | 83mm |
| Daily sunshine | 7.2hrs | 7.5hrs |
July trade-offs
- ↓European summer school holiday surge: prices spike to near-January levels
- ↓Chaweng Beach at capacity again — booking 2–3 months ahead for decent mid-range options
- ↓Occasional heavy rain still possible; the weather is better than May–June but not as reliable as January
April trade-offs
- ↓Songkran week: hotel prices spike temporarily and transport books up fast
- ↓83mm of rain is manageable but occasional heavy afternoon showers begin appearing
- ↓Peak heat of 32.8°C: demanding for any strenuous outdoor activity between 11am and 3pm
